Dumbo-HQ.webp Dumbo is the best known elephant character in popular culture, and has been since the 1940's. Dumbo is an animated Disney film that came out in 1941 and is rumored to be Walt Disney's favorite film. Dumbo is based upon a book with the same name. It's the story of Dumbo, a big elephant who is ridiculed for his huge ears. However, we come to learn that Dumbo is actually able to fly using his big ears as wings. Dumbo turned out to be the most financially successful Disney film of the 1940's. It was also re-released theatrically in 1959, 1972, and 1976, and was one of the first Disney animated films on television in the 1980's. Dumbo also inspired the original 1955 attraction, Flying Elephants, at Disneyland, and can also be found at Magic Kingdom's Fantasyland. Of course, we cannot forget the popular series of Disney's Dumbo books.

babar-the-elephant-books.webp Children from all over the world have been fascinated with Babar the elephant for over 75 years now. Babar is a character who first debuted in 1931 in the children's book, "L'Histoire de Babar in France."" The book was an immediate success and English versions were published by 1933. The Babar stories are based around the premise that Babar, a young elephant, leaves the jungle to visit a big city. He then returns to the jungle, bringing home everything civilization has taught him. All of the Babar stories teach simple values, and thus have made the character quite popular with children. In 1989. the first of four Babar films debuted, and an animated tv series ran from 1989 to 1991. This series is available in 30 languages in over 150 countries. Babar has come to be one of the largest distributed animation shows in history. There are also now over 30,000 publications in over 17 different languages, and over 8 million books have sold."

snuffy.webp Snuffleupagus is yet another well known and adored elephant character from the classic children's TV series "Sesame Street."" This lovable shaggy brown elephant-like creature debuted on the show in 1971 as Big Bird's friend. Snuffleupagus was originally the kind, imaginary friend of Big Bird. However in 1985, Snuffleupagus was seen by everybody for the first time."

Horton-Elephant.webp Horton the elephant is another loveable elephant from the famed Dr. Seuss book series. Horton is an elephant who spends his life caring about people and other animals. He always overcomes life's obstacles by being honest, kind, funny and strong. It's because of these qualities that he became such a loved character by the public. Horton also was a character on the TV series "The Wubbulous World of Dr. Seuss."" Horton is also played by Jim Carrey in the computer animated adaption of the Dr. Seuss book from 1954, entitled ""Horton Hears A Who."""
